Output 67e21c3028c2b39c8287c0118aa6688d573605fd341ab04b3d1c300332c61733:2

value
64972821018
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 60a908e97f2558208697aa4bdac0c32e08e3ce4f OP_EQUALVERIFY OP_CHECKSIG
address
LU33dNcUat93ZzeBN6svgXAJQMRJWWsQtH
transaction
67e21c3028c2b39c8287c0118aa6688d573605fd341ab04b3d1c300332c61733
spent
true